Meaning
Structural sealants are designed to provide long-lasting adhesion and sealing capabilities in structural applications. They are typically used in bonding curtain walls, facades, and other architectural elements to the building structure. These sealants offer excellent flexibility, allowing them to accommodate movements and stresses that occur within structures, such as thermal expansion and contraction.

Category-wise Insights
- Silicone-based structural sealants: Silicone-based sealants dominate the market due to their excellent weatherability, UV resistance, and durability. They find extensive application in high-rise buildings and facades.
- Polyurethane structural sealants: Polyurethane sealants offer high strength, flexibility, and adhesion. They are widely used in construction applications requiring bonding and sealing properties.
- Hybrid structural sealants: Hybrid sealants combine the properties of silicone and polyurethane sealants. They offer a balance between flexibility, adhesion, and weatherability.
